
Buses from Harlingen, TX to Lexington, KY travel the 1125mi (1810.51km) journey, taking approximately 2d, 1h. Usually, there is 1 bus operating per day. While the average ticket price for this journey is around $340.85, you can find the cheapest bus tickets for as low as $340.85.

If you’re looking for a bluegrass adventure without breaking the piggy bank, a bus to Lexington, KY is your ticket to an unforgettable escape. Known as the Horse Capital of the World, Lexington is famous for its picturesque horse farms and the Kentucky Horse Park. Even if you’re not a horse enthusiast, the sight of these beautiful creatures is a sure way to connect with the town’s authentic spirit.
Once you’ve enjoyed the equestrian scenery, take a detour into Lexington’s thriving bourbon trail. Visit local distilleries for a taste of Kentucky’s finest - a liquid icon as proud as the horses. And speaking of icons, downtown Lexington offers a vibrant mix of attractions, including the Mary Todd Lincoln House, which offers a historic insight and a charming afternoon exploration.
End the day with a stroll through the University of Kentucky Arboretum, a perfect spot for finding tranquility amid the town’s lush greenery.
